JCC Basketball Teams Win Regular Season Openers

JAMESTOWN – Both the Men’s and Women’s JCC Jayhawks basketball teams defeated Tompkins Cortland Community College Thursday night to open their regular seasons.
The Lady Jayhawks won by a score of 73-49, while the men narrowly won 82-80.
Haley Hettenbaugh led the way for JCC with a 24-point, 13-rebound double-double. Hettenbaugh also tallied three assists, four steals, and netted six three-pointers.
Nicole Johnson added 12 points and seven rebounds. Jesse Zenns chipped in with 10 points, four rebounds, and three steals off the bench.
The TCCC women’s team made just 34.4% of their shots (21-61), and made just five of 23 three-point attempts.
In men’s action, JCC came back from a 44-26 halftime deficit to win.
Chris Robson led JCC with 18 points, while adding three rebounds, four assists, and two steals. Robson also nailed four three-pointers.
Jared Fish scored 13 points, and snagged nine rebounds.
The TCCC men’s team shot 45.7% (32-70), but went just 3-17 from three-point range. TCCC also struggled at the free-throw line, shooting 13-22 (59.1%.)
The JCC Basketball teams will play again, this time at home, on Saturday against SUNY Broome Community College for the Crossover Classic.
Tip-off for the women’s game will be at 3 p.m., while the men’s game will start at 5 p.m.
